The Big Kahuna: How Much Moolah Are We Talking?

Alright, alright, let's get down to brass tacks. According to internet sleuths (aka salary data gurus), CNAs in Washington rake in an average of $42,430 a year. That translates to a cool $20.40 an hour. Not too shabby, right? Especially when you consider the national average for CNAs is a smidge lower.

But wait, there's more! Washington's minimum wage is a decent chunk of change at $15.74. So, being a CNA puts you comfortably above minimum wage territory. Boom! Financial independence, here you come (with a side of adulting, of course).

Now, here's the kicker: This is all just an average, like a lukewarm cup of coffee. Your actual salary can vary depending on a few sneaky ninjas:

  • Location, location, location! Big city lights often mean bigger paychecks. Seattle might have you rolling in dough compared to a smaller town.
  • Experience is everything (well, almost everything). The more years you've been a CNA, the more you can potentially command. Think of it like leveling up in a video game, but with real-life skills instead of magical swords.
  • Shift differentials can be your BFF. Working nights, weekends, or holidays often comes with a bonus on your paycheck. So if you're a night owl, this could be your chance to snag some extra cash (and avoid all those pesky social gatherings).
  • Some employers are just plain nicer (and richer). Facilities with bigger budgets might offer more competitive salaries and benefits to attract top talent.

The moral of the story? Don't be afraid to shop around and compare offers!
